A man claims he was assaulted by Dolphins C Mike Pouncey and Steelers C Maurkice Pouncey at the twins' birthday party at Cameo Nightclub in Miami Beach Friday night.
The alleged victim Ricky Vasquez took to Twitter, claiming he was "jumped by 4 bouncers and the Pouncey Twins." Vasquez added he was attacked because of his sexual orientation, claiming the assailants used homophobic slurs and saying, "I feel like I just got gay bashed." The Miami Beach PD released a statement saying, "There was an incident that occurred at Cameo last night at 4:20 a.m., where an alleged assault took place. We have not confirmed it's the Pouncey brothers that are the subjects, but we are going to have detectives contacting the victims to investigate further." This is not the first time the brothers' birthday party has made the news. The two got into hot water at last year's event for wearing "Free Hernandez" hats in support of former Patriots TE Aaron Hernandez. This incident is obviously more serious, and if founded, could lead to legal action as well as suspensions for each player.
Source: Broward Palm Beach New Times

Larry English - LB - Free Agent
Chargers released OLB Larry English.
English was the 16th overall pick in the 2009 draft and is not subject to waivers. The 28-year-old has missed 28 games over the past four seasons mostly due to right foot problems. He has 11 career sacks across 52 career games, but has never accumulated more than three in a season. English's roster spot has been in jeopardy the past couple years, and GM Tom Telesco finally cut the cord. He should be able to latch on with another team for the summer.
Related: Chargers
Source: Adam Schefter on Twitter
